Problem beim Einfügen neuer Elemente
Thomas
- javascript
Hallo Community.
Ich habe beim Erstellen von dynamischen Inhalten in eine HTML-Datei zur Laufzeit Probleme:
1. Ich habe einige Select Felder aus denen ein User Werte auswählen kann.
2. Wenn er einen Wert ausgewählt hat, füllt sich das nächste Select Feld mit bestimmten Werten. Die neuen Felder werden dynamisch dur JS erzeugt.
3. Schlussendlich soll ein Textarea mit einem Text zur entsprechenden Auswahl angezeigt werden.
Folgendes Problem:
Ich kann die Felder nur per document.getElemByID().innerhtml einfügen - document.createElement funktioniert nicht. Warum auch immer
Füge ich bei Erstellung der Select Felder einen onchange Event ein, wird diese Funktion nicht angesprungen. Alle anderen Angaben zu Größe, Aussehen und Inhalt funktionieren.
Ich hoffe ihr könnt mir helfen.
MfG
Thomas
hi,
Ich kann die Felder nur per document.getElemByID().innerhtml einfügen - document.createElement funktioniert nicht. Warum auch immer
Ja, warum auch immer ...
gruß,
wahsaga
hi,
Ich kann die Felder nur per document.getElemByID().innerhtml einfügen - document.createElement funktioniert nicht. Warum auch immer
Ja, warum auch immer ...
gruß,
wahsaga
»»
Hi,
Ich verstehe zwar nicht, was diese hoch qualifizierte Antwort soll, aber nochmal zum Thema: Ich hätte gern einen Hinweis, warum die Funktion bei einem onchange Event nicht angesprungen wird. Das Element habe ich vorher per JS in Textform (innerhtml) eingefügt.
Ein Erzeugen des Elements mit createElement funktioniert leider nicht - ich weiß auch nicht warum. Ich hatte es so wie im Tutorial beschrieben, programmiert.
MfG
Thomas
Hell-O!
Ich verstehe zwar nicht, was diese hoch qualifizierte Antwort soll
Dir kann ohne exakte Fehlerbeschreibung nicht geholfen werden. Bei Javascript-Problemen gehören immer Fehlermeldungen der Javascript-Konsole und Debugging-Ergebnisse dazu, siehe auch Zitat Nr. 186. Darüber hinaus ist relevanter Code und ggf. ein Link zur Problemseite erforderlich.
Siechfred